The Importance of Making Compensation Claims When Your Are Injured In An Accident

Personal Injury Lawyer

In a recent interview a lawyer working for a team of Hartford, CT personal injury lawyers spoke about the shocking number of people who fail to claim compensation after an accident that wasn’t their fault.

There are a number of reasons why this could be the case, some believe that they are not entitled to a payout, others think that compensation isn’t right and many more simply don’t consider it.

The reality however is that compensation claims form a very important part of the legal process, and here is why you should claim if you are injured because of an accident that wasn’t your fault.

Covering The Costs Of An Injury

Getting injured is going to cost you money, and the severity of the injury will dictate just how much. In many cases, you are going to have soaring medical bills which your health insurance provider may not cover, insurance premiums to pay if your car was involved, as well as a potential loss of earnings if you’re unable to work.

Even if you have sick pay from your job, you are going to be unable to work overtime for example, which can limit your ability to earn. This is the main reason why compensation exists, in order to pay for the costs of the injury.

Preventing Issues From Reoccurring

Bringing these kinds of cases forward is not just about the money, it is also about making a company or an organization aware of their negligence so that they will take steps that will greatly minimize the chances of such an accident happening again.

Now, this is not going to help you and your injury right now, but there is a certain sense of civic duty that we all have, and bringing forth a claim like this will hopefully mean that nobody else suffers a similar fate in the future.

Purpose of Insurance Companies

Another important consideration to make here is that insurance companies are designed to cover this kind of incident. This is exactly why building and business owners take out insurance so that it can cover the potential risks of an accident taking place.

If you fail to claim compensation when you are involved in an accident then the insurance companies will keep this money, which of course is not right.

Punishment

In most cases of negligence, there is no criminal activity by the responsible party, and therefore the only way to really give out any kind of punishment is to hit them in the pocket.

As we have mentioned, these companies will have insurance companies that will take on these cases, but when the insurance company has to pay out, they will in turn increase the cost of future premiums for their clients. And so in claiming the compensation you can still punish the guilty party, by way of increasing their costs.

This is not the perfect way to deal with this situation of course, but given that the clock cannot be turned back, it is the best option which we currently have following this kind of accident.
